The origins of ice cream, sorbet and other chilled dairy treats are difficult to pin down—but span back to antiquity. According to popular legend, ice cream was invented by the ancient Chinese, brought to Italy by Marco Polo, to France by Catherine de Medici, and thence to America by Thomas Jefferson.

Who is the father of ice cream? ›
Augustus Jackson was dubbed the Father of Ice Cream because he revolutionized the ice cream making process. He was the first one who used salt to make the ice melt slower. His ice cream making process and recipes revolutionized ice cream in Philadelphia.

Did Thomas Jefferson invent ice cream? ›
While the claim that Thomas Jefferson introduced ice cream to the United States is demonstrably false, he can be credited with the first known recipe recorded by an American. Jefferson also likely helped to popularize ice cream in this country when he served it at the President's House in Washington.
How was the ice cream maker invented? ›
In 1843, Nancy Johnson, an American, patented the first hand-cranked model which revolutionized the preparation of ice cream by making the process more efficient. This innovation allowed a democratization of ice consumption, which was no longer reserved for elites with access to natural coolers.
Who brought ice cream to America? ›
Ice cream's origins
But it was British confectioner Philip Lenzi who introduced ice cream to America. In 1774, Lenzi put an ad in the New York Gazette announcing that he would make ice cream available to the masses. It didn't it take long to sweep the (soon-to-be) nation.
Who invented the first ice cream churn? ›
Nancy Johnson patented the first hand-cranked model in 1843. William Young produced the machine as the "Johnson Patent Ice-Cream Freezer" in 1848. Hand-cranked machines' ice and salt mixture must be replenished to make a batch of ice cream.
